Bearings are of two main types: ball bearings and roller bearings. Similarities and Differences: Let’s sort them out. Ball bearings use tiny, spherical balls to hold the weight. The balls distribute the load uniformly over the bearing’s surface. For lighter loads, this is fantastic.” Particularly, unlike ball bearings, roller bearings incorporate larger, cylindrical rollers. These rollers have a larger contact area, giving them the capacity to carry heavier loads. Roller bearings are therefore more suited for huge machines or equipment.

Different shapes and designs of ball and roller bearings are available for different applications. As an instance, deep groove ball bearings have specific grooves in them which help them in accommodating different forms of load. Axial as well as radial; they can take side to side loads along with up and down. That makes them incredibly versatile. Then you have angular contact ball bearings, which are specifically made to take thrust loads, so they can handle loads pushing at an angle. Also, another type is tapered roller bearings that is designed for heavy-duty work. These axial bearings are capable to carry out a lot more than just high radial loads, they are designed to handle high axial loads, making them an excellent option for application on heavy machinery.
